Есть ли полиморфизм в языках с динамической типизацией? Есть ли полиморфизм в языке python?
Если есть то в каком виде он выражается?
На примере с языками со статической типизацией - понятно зачем он нужен.

7 Апр 2020 в 19:45
212 +1
0
Ответы
1

Да, полиморфизм есть и в языках с динамической типизацией, включая Python. Полиморфизм в Python можно реализовать с помощью функций/методов, которые могут принимать на вход объекты различных типов и выполнять соответствующие операции в зависимости от типа переданных объектов.

Например, в Python можно использовать механизм динамической типизации и перегрузки операторов для реализации полиморфизма. Также в Python есть возможность использовать наследование классов и полиморфизм через переопределение методов.

В целом, полиморфизм в Python позволяет осуществлять различные действия с различными типами данных, что упрощает программирование и повышает гибкость кода.

18 Апр 2024 в 14:27
Не можешь разобраться в этой теме?
Обратись за помощью к экспертам
Название заказа не должно быть пустым
Введите email
Бесплатные доработки
Гарантированные бесплатные доработки
Быстрое выполнение
Быстрое выполнение от 2 часов
Проверка работы
Проверка работы на плагиат
Интересные статьи из справочника
Поможем написать учебную работу
Название заказа не должно быть пустым
Введите email
Доверьте свою работу экспертам
Разместите заказ
Наша система отправит ваш заказ на оценку 95 297 авторам
Первые отклики появятся уже в течение 10 минут
Прямой эфир